Information and Error Messages Table 9: Product Manager Messages (Continued) Message No firmware version file was selected. No firmware versions to delete. Nonredundant director must be offline to install firmware. Not all of the optical transceivers are installed for this range of ports. Open Trunking is not installed for this product. Please contact your sales representative. Performing this action will overwrite the date/time on the switch. Performing this operation will change the current state to Offline. Description A file was not selected in the Firmware Library dialog box before an action, such as modify or send was performed. There are no firmware versions in the firmware library to delete, therefore the operation cannot be performed. If the director has only one CTP card, the director must be set offline to install a firmware version. Some ports in the specified range do not have optical transceivers installed. The Open Trunking feature key has not been enabled. This message only displays if the optional Open Trunking feature is installed. Warning that occurs when configuring the date and time through the Configure Date and Time dialog box, that the new time or date will overwrite the existing time or date set for the director or switch. This message requests confirmation to set the director offline. Action Click on a firmware version in the dialog box to select it, then perform the action again. Informational message only-no action is required. Set the director offline and install the firmware. Use a port range that is valid for the ports installed. Enter the feature key into the Configure Feature Key dialog box and enable the key. If you require a feature key, see your account representative. Verify that you want to overwrite the current date or time. Click OK to set the director offline or click Cancel to cancel the operation. 224 Director Product Manager User Guide
